Kollmorgen BR-4500-3017-B

Product Name:​ BR-Series Brushless Servo Motor (legacy ID-frame line)
Product Introduction:​ High-performance 3-phase brushless DC servo motor from the discontinued Kollmorgen BR/ID family, intended for demanding industrial motion axes where mid-power torque and resolver feedback are acceptable.

Technical Specifications:
  • Frame size:​ 3.0 in (76 mm) OD, flange-mounted
  • Rated power:​ ~60 W (some listings show 6.9 hp / 210 V variant confusion; verified BR-4500-3017-B is a low-voltage 24 VDC unit at 60 W, while the 210 V / 6.9 hp listing refers to a different BR-4500 winding)
  • Rated voltage:​ 24 VDC (alternative AC windings existed)
  • Rated current:​ 2.5 A
  • Rated speed:​ 4500 RPM
  • Rated torque:​ 0.16 Nm (continuous); stall torque 3.0 Nm; peak 7.8 Nm depending on winding
  • Feedback:​ 2-pole resolver (standard), optional 2048 CPR incremental encoder on some variants
  • Protection:​ IP65 (sealed housing, shaft seal)
  • Weight:​ ~1.2 kg (low-voltage version)
    Functional Features:
  • Brushless commutation → low maintenance, long bearing life
  • Ribbed aluminum housing for natural convection cooling
  • Neodymium magnet rotor for high dynamic response
  • Standard NEMA/metric hybrid mounting flange
    Application Scenarios:​ Packaging machinery, semiconductor handlers, robotic joints, lab automation, legacy machine retrofit.
    Installation Requirements:​ Flange or foot mount on rigid metal; shield feedback cable; avoid solvent-based cleaners on matte-black paint.
    Usage Notes:​ Not plug-and-play with AKD drives without resolver-to-digital tuning; verify winding label before applying bus voltage.
